Applicability <br /> Via) Beginning January 1 2010 all planting irrigation and landscape <br /> related improvements required by this Article shall apply to the <br /> following landscape projects <br /> (1) new landscape installations or landscape rehabilitation <br /> projects by public agencies or private non-residential <br /> developers, except for cemeteries with a landscaped area <br /> including pools or other water features but excluding <br /> hardscape, equal to or greater than 2 500 square feet and <br /> which are otherwise subject to a discretionary approval of a <br /> landscape plan or which otherwise require a ministerial <br /> permit for a landscape or water feature <br /> (2) new landscape installations or landscape rehabilitation <br /> projects by developers or property managers of single family <br /> and multi-family residential projects or complexes with a <br /> landscaped area including pools or other water features but <br /> excludina hardscape equal to or greater than 2 500 square <br /> feet, and which are otherwise subject to a discretionary <br /> approval of a landscape plan or which otherwise require a <br /> ministerial permit for a landscape or water feature <br /> ~3) new landscape installation projects by individual <br /> homeowners on single-family or multi-family residential lots <br /> with a total project landscaped area including pools or other <br /> water features but excluding hardscape equal to or greater <br /> than 5,000 square feet and which are otherwise subject to a <br /> discretionary approval of a landscape plan or which <br /> otherwise require a ministerial permit for a landscape or <br /> water feature: <br /> A landscape rehabilitation project is subject to the <br /> requirements of this Article where (i) the modified <br /> landscaped area is greater than 2 500 square feet and <br /> Ordinance No. NS-XXX <br /> Page 27 of 33 <br /> 75A-89 <br /> <br />
